GENERAL DESCRIPTION: The Child and Family Therapist or Counselor  is responsible for providing direct therapeutic services to victims of child abuse, trauma, and other Adverse Childhood Experiences (ACEs) and their families in crisis and on an ongoing basis. The Child and Family Therapist or Counselor  is trained in evidence-based—NCA approved models to address the trauma, mental health, and other clinical issues that clients and their non-offending caregivers may present. This position is required to provide ongoing therapy, court prep, and support group treatment to clients and their non-offending caregivers. The Child and Family Therapist position is for developing and maintaining a client-focused, children’s advocacy-based mental health practice that supports the mission of VCAC and adheres to the NCA Standards of Mental Health practices.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S OF THE JOB:

  • Provide individual & family mental health therapy for children and their non-offending families in crisis and on an ongoing basis using an evidence- based and NCA approved therapy model
  • Provide structured group and support therapy program for children and caregivers
  • Provide comprehensive bio-psycho-social assessments for child victims of trauma and maltreatment
  • Provide individual parenting education, to include the effects of abuse, violence and trauma on children
  • Introduce and support coping skills necessary to help the child deal with the impact of trauma when at home and in other settings
  • Assist with crisis counseling of new clients as needed
  • Attend and participate in meetings, trainings and supervision as requested
  • Follow and adhere to the NCA accreditation standards for mental providers and use the best practices
  • Assist in developing and conducting applicable trainings relative to VCAC’s mission and its Mental Health program for multidisciplinary team member organizations and other partner organizations
  • Responsible for ensuring service is client-focused, culturally competent and sensitive, strength based, and built on a foundation of sound clinical theory and trauma informed best practices
  • Ensure the collection and integrity of client/service data and report findings monthly and timely
  • Offer feedback for service adaptation based on best practices established by research in the field
  • Schedule of therapeutic appointments within established timeframes
  • Communicate effectively with clients, caregivers, and MDT partners
  • Represent the program and agency with area service providers

Qualification, Skills, Knowledge

 

  • Educational Requirement: Masters in Social Worker (LLMSW or LMSW) or Licensed Professional Counselor. Preferred Trained in Trauma-Focused Cognitive Behavior Therapy (TF-CBT)
  • Knowledgeable about child development and family systems, diagnosis, and evidence based therapeutic interventions for children who have experienced trauma
  • Knowledgeable about the dynamics of sexual abuse, physical abuse and neglect
  • Knowledgeable about the dynamics of intimate partner violence
